Understanding Your Insignia TV
Insignia TVs are known for their impressive picture quality, affordability, and robust features. Depending on the model, these televisions may run on various operating systems, primarily Fire TV for Insignia Fire TV editions and Roku for Insignia Roku TVs. The approach to downloading apps might vary based on the operating system, so it’s vital to identify your TV type before following the instructions.
Identifying Your Insignia TV Model
Before we delve into the downloading process, follow these steps to identify your Insignia TV model:
- Check the box your Insignia TV came in; model numbers are usually printed on the packaging.
- Navigate to the “Settings” menu on your TV. The model number is often displayed in the “About” section.
Knowing your Insignia TV model will help you better understand how to navigate its interface and download apps.
Downloading Apps on Insignia Fire TV Edition
If you own an Insignia Fire TV Edition, downloading apps is straightforward. Fire TV runs on the Amazon Fire OS, which offers a vast range of streaming services. Here’s a step-by-step guide to help you get started.
Step 1: Turn on Your Insignia Fire TV
Start by turning on your Insignia Fire TV and ensuring you are connected to the Wi-Fi network. Your remote control should have a dedicated button for Power.
Step 2: Navigate to the Home Screen
Once your TV is on, press the “Home” button on your remote. This will take you to the Fire TV home screen where you will see various content suggestions and app icons.
Step 3: Access the App Store
On the home screen, scroll down to the “Apps” section. This is where you can access the Amazon Appstore available for your Fire TV.
Step 4: Browse or Search for Apps
You can either scroll through the featured apps or use the search bar at the top of the screen. If you have a specific app in mind (like Netflix, Hulu, or YouTube), type its name using the on-screen keyboard.
App Categories
To make your search easier, apps are categorized into sections such as Movies & TV, Games, News, and more. This helps you discover new apps that suit your interests.
Step 5: Select the App and Start Downloading
Once you’ve found the app you’d like to download, click on it to view more details. Here, you will see an option to “Get” or “Download” the app. Select this option, and the app will begin downloading.
Step 6: Launch the App
After the download is complete, the app will appear in your app list on the home screen. Click on the app icon to launch it and begin your streaming adventures.
Downloading Apps on Insignia Roku TV
Insignia Roku TVs offer a different ecosystem with their own set of apps. If your Insignia TV operates on the Roku platform, follow these steps to download your desired applications.
Step 1: Power on Your Insignia Roku TV
Use your remote control to power on your Roku TV. Make sure you’re connected to the internet.
Step 2: Go to the Roku Home Screen
Press the “Home” button on your Roku remote to access the main screen, filled with tiles representing your installed channels.
Step 3: Access the Roku Channel Store
Scroll down the home screen and look for “Streaming Channels.” Select this option to enter the Roku Channel Store, where you can find new apps.
Step 4: Explore or Search for Specific Channels
You can browse through categories like Movies & TV, Sports, News, and more. Alternatively, you can use the search function at the top of the screen to find specific channels, such as Disney+, HBO Max, or others.
Step 5: Click on the Channel and Add it
Once you find the channel you want, click on it to see its details. Then, select the “Add Channel” option to start downloading the app to your Insignia Roku TV.
Step 6: Return to the Home Screen and Launch the App
After the installation finishes, return to the home screen. The new channel will now appear among your existing channels. Click on it to open and enjoy the content.
Tips for a Smooth App Downloading Experience
To ensure that your app downloading experience on Insignia TV is as smooth as possible, keep the following tips in mind:
Ensure Your TV Software is Up to Date
Make sure that your Insignia TV’s software is updated to the latest version. You can check for software updates in the settings menu. An up-to-date system will ensure app compatibility and improve your overall user experience.
Stable Internet Connection
Having a stable internet connection is critically important when downloading apps. If your network is unstable, it may lead to incomplete downloads or streaming issues. Consider using a wired connection for better stability, especially for larger apps or updates.

Are there any limitations on the apps I can download?
Yes, there are limitations on the apps you can download on your Insignia TV based on device compatibility and the platform it runs on. Some apps may not be available for certain versions of Insignia TVs, especially if they are older or do not support the latest software updates.
Additionally, certain apps may have geographical restrictions, limiting their availability based on your location. Therefore, it is important to check the compatibility of specific applications with your Insignia TV before attempting to download them.
What should I do if I can’t find a specific app?
If you cannot find a specific app in your Insignia TV’s app store, first ensure that your TV is running the latest software version. Sometimes, an app may not appear due to outdated software, which can restrict access to newer applications. Check for any available updates in the settings menu and install them if needed.
If the app still isn’t available after updating, consider alternative methods such as screen mirroring from your smartphone or tablet. Many users opt to stream content from their devices directly to their TV if the app is not supported, so utilizing this feature can help you access your desired content.
Is it possible to remove apps from my Insignia TV?
Yes, you can remove apps from your Insignia TV when they are no longer needed. This can help free up space on your device and streamline your app menu. The process for uninstalling apps varies slightly between systems, so ensure you follow the right steps according to whether you are using Fire TV or Roku.
For Fire TV, highlight the app you wish to uninstall, press the “Options” button on your remote, and then select “Uninstall” from the menu. On Roku, simply navigate to the app on the home screen, press the “Star” button, and choose “Remove Channel.” Both processes are quick and efficient, allowing you to customize your app selection easily.
